dc.description.abstractDangke and dadih is milk processing product from South Sulawesi and West Sumatera. Dangke had total plate count, yeast and mold, and lactic acid bacteria, respectively 6,4 x 108 cfu/g, 2,5 x 108 cfu/g, 2,8 x 105 cfu/g; and dadih had 7,3 x 108 cfu/ml, 9,0 x 107 cfu/ml, 1,5 x 105 cfu/ml. Dangke and dadih had higher sensitivity to Gram positive than Gram negative bacteria. Based on protein molecular weight, then dangke and dadih had peptide that included to glicoprotein.id
